  • Broken Base: The kiss scene between Hook and Emma in this episode is a major point of contention within the fandom even to this day. There is one camp who find it super romantic and a good next step in their romance, especially due to Jennifer Morrison and Colin O'Donoghue's chemistry. However, there is also a camp that find it more creepy than romantic, and feel that it is out of place in a season where Emma is otherwise more focused on saving her son than romance. Even years later, this scene is the subject of major flame wars.
  • Unintentionally Unsympathetic: Hook and Emma kissing after Hook saves her father is supposed to be charming and romantic, but a lot of fans find it a bit hard to swallow on Hook's end. The sticking point is Hook seemingly pressing Emma for the kiss due to saving her dad, basically asking for a reward for doing the right thing, even if that was not the intention. While it's meant to be a flirty little back and forth between the two, some of Hook's dialogue, such as "That's all your father's life is worth to you?", reads as accidentally manipulative. Add to this Emma originally turning down kissing him, and you have the reason a lot of fans see it as creepy instead of romantic.
